01

Pump Control

Lead/lag, duty/standby, alternation, minimum run times, dry-run protection and fault changeover.

  • Auto / manual modes
  • VFD speed demand
  • Pressure / level PID interfaces
  • Failover logic
02

Instrumentation & Analog Control

Scale and validate process instruments and provide operator-visible engineering values.

  • 4–20 mA scaling
  • Bad-signal detection
  • High / low alarms
  • Trend-ready values
